site stats

Dtw vs soft dtw clustering

WebSuppose x is a time series that is constant except for a motif that occurs at some point in the series, and let us denote by x + k a copy of x in which the motif is temporally shifted by k timestamps. Then the quantity. soft … Web3.3 Soft-DTW centroid; 4 Clustering experiments. 4.1 TADPole; 4.2 DTW special cases. 4.2.1 PAM centroids; 4.2.2 DBA centroids; ... 2.1.4 Soft-DTW. In principle, the soft-DTW …

Applying Dynamic Time Warping (DTW) instead of

We have seen in a previous blog posthow one can use Dynamic Time Warping (DTW) as a shift-invariant similarity measure between time series. In this new post, we will study some aspects related to the differentiability of DTW. One of the reasons why we focus on differentiability is that this property is key in … See more Let us start by having a look at the differentiability of Dynamic Time Warping. To do so, we will rely on the following theorem from … See more Soft-DTW [CuBl17]has been introduced as a way to mitigate this limitation. The formal definition for soft-DTW is the following: soft-DTWγ(x,x′)=minπ∈A(x,x′)γ∑(i,j)∈πd(xi,xj′)2 where minγ is the … See more We have seen in this post that DTW is not differentiable everywhere, and that there exists alternatives that basically change the min operator into a differentiable alternative in order to … See more WebMoved Permanently. The document has moved here. cvs south high 43207 https://kusholitourstravels.com

Alignment-based Metrics in Machine Learning

WebOct 23, 2024 · Time Warping (DTW) distance as dissimilarity measure (Aghabozorgi et al. 2015). The calculation of the DTW distance involves a dynamic programming algorithm … WebMar 22, 2024 · Dynamic Time Warping (DTW) is a widely used distance measurement in time series clustering. DTW distance is invariant to time series phase perturbations but … http://cs.ucr.edu/~eamonn/UCRsuite.html cvs south high st columbus

Clustering time series data using dynamic time warping

Category:Time Series Clustering — tslearn 0.5.3.2 documentation

Tags:Dtw vs soft dtw clustering

Dtw vs soft dtw clustering

dtwclust-package function - RDocumentation

WebMay 5, 2012 · Implementations of partitional, hierarchical, fuzzy, k-Shape and TADPole clustering are available. Functionality can be easily extended with custom distance … WebMay 5, 2012 · Implementations of partitional, hierarchical, fuzzy, k-Shape and TADPole clustering are available. Functionality can be easily extended with custom distance measures and centroid definitions. Implementations of DTW barycenter averaging, a distance based on global alignment kernels, and the soft-DTW distance and centroid …

Dtw vs soft dtw clustering

Did you know?

WebOct 2024. Lei Wang. Piotr Koniusz. Dynamic Time Warping (DTW) is used for matching pairs of sequences and celebrated in applications such as forecasting the evo- lution of … WebJul 17, 2024 · Footnote: The main advantage of soft-DTW stems from the fact that it is differentiable everywhere. This allows soft-DTW to be used as a neural networks loss function, comparing a ground-truth series and a predicted series. from tslearn.metrics import soft_dtw soft_dtw_score = soft_dtw(x, y, gamma=.1) K-means Clustering with …

WebAug 6, 2024 · ABSTRACT. We propose in this paper a differentiable learning loss between time series, building upon the celebrated dynamic time warping (DTW) discrepancy. Unlike the Euclidean distance, DTW can compare time series of variable size and is robust to shifts or dilatations across the time dimension. To compute DTW, one typically solves a … WebJan 6, 2015 · DTW will assign a rather small distance to these two series. However, if you compute the mean of the two series, it will be a flat 0 - they cancel out. The mean does …

Webwhere X_train is the considered unlabelled dataset of time series. The metric parameter can also be set to "softdtw" as an alternative time series metric (cf. our User Guide section on … WebJul 23, 2024 · I am trying to cluster members based on hourly login data. As this is mostly synchronized, I first applied Euclidean and it failed to cluster them into groups with …

WebMar 4, 2024 · We finally applied soft-DTW (soft-dynamic time warping) k-means clustering (Cuturi and Blondel, 2024) to identify groups of similar trajectories. To decide the optimal …

WebDec 1, 2011 · mlpy is a Python module for Machine Learning built on top of NumPy/SciPy and the GNU Scientific Libraries.. mlpy provides a wide range of state-of-the-art machine learning methods for supervised and unsupervised problems and it is aimed at finding a reasonable compromise among modularity, maintainability, reproducibility, usability and … cheap flights from shanghai to tokyoWebJun 28, 2024 · Below is the code I use so far to do the clustering work. for j in [2,3]: # try 2 and 3 clusters km = TimeSeriesKMeans (n_clusters=j, metric="softdtw") labels = km.fit_predict (ts_intention_list) silhouetteScore = silhouette_score (ts_intention_list, labels, metric="softdtw") print (f"\nLabels for {j} clusters: {labels}") num_of_clusters_list ... cvs south gateway driveWebDynamic Time Warping (DTW) 1 is a similarity measure between time series. Let us consider two time series x = ( x 0, …, x n − 1) and y = ( y 0, …, y m − 1) of respective … cvs south hill street griffin gaWebApr 16, 2014 · Arguments --------- n_neighbors : int, optional (default = 5) Number of neighbors to use by default for KNN max_warping_window : int, optional (default = infinity) Maximum warping window allowed by the DTW dynamic programming function subsample_step : int, optional (default = 1) Step size for the timeseries array. cheap flights from shanghai to taipeiWebApr 16, 2014 · Classification and Clustering. Now that we have a reliable method to determine the similarity between two time series, we can use the k-NN algorithm for classification. Empirically, the best results have come when k = 1. The following is the 1-NN algorithm that uses dynamic time warping Euclidean distance. cvs south hayes street arlington vaWebAug 31, 2024 · The result is a DTW distance of 1. from dtaidistance import dtw import numpy as np y = np.random.randint (0,10,10) y1 = y [1:] dist = dtw.distance (y, y1) I am not completely sure how to interpret the dtw distance. Dynamic Time Warping measures the distance between series of data points where the order of data points in each series is … cvs south grafton massWebOct 23, 2024 · Time Warping (DTW) distance as dissimilarity measure (Aghabozorgi et al. 2015). The calculation of the DTW distance involves a dynamic programming algorithm that tries to nd the optimum warping path between two series under certain constraints. However, the DTW algorithm is computationally expensive, both in time and memory … cvs south hill va 23970